Delivery drones, quadcopter drones, and the drone quadcopter are revolutionizing the means we view logistics, innovation, and airborne technology. Over the past decade, drones have flawlessly transitioned from being a technological novelty to an indispensable device across numerous markets, with delivery drones leading the charge in redefining the retail landscape.

Quadcopter drones have actually made delivery systems quicker, extra ecologically pleasant, and most importantly, much more reliable. With the capability to carry numerous goods, from publications to emergency clinical supplies, they're breaking obstacles that when restricted standard logistics. These drones rely upon intricate algorithms and progressed GPS innovations to traverse their courses. In metropolitan landscapes, where fully of airspace needs to be thoroughly accounted for, quadcopter drones succeed because of their upright launch and touchdown capabilities, enabling them to bypass ground-level blockage. Their capacity to hover and preserve excellent security even in challenging weather condition problems makes them the vehicle of choice for time-sensitive shipments.

Yet, the value of quadcopter drones expands past plain delivery. They represent the junction where fabricated knowledge meets aviation, constantly adapting and learning. Through device understanding formulas, these drones can recognize the fastest courses, maneuver around barriers in real-time, and also get used to no-fly areas determined by governmental guidelines. This vibrant adaptation isn't almost efficiency; it's important for security. As they operate within airspaces frequently populated with both manned and unmanned airplane, ensuring zero disturbance is paramount. Hence, business investing in delivery drone innovation prioritize robust software alongside advanced hardware, guaranteeing smooth interactions within these shared airspaces.

Delivery drones are decreasing carbon footprints, heralding a greener future. Typical delivery systems typically depend on nonrenewable fuel sources, contributing significantly to city contamination. On the other hand, electric drones harness eco-friendly electrical energy, minimizing exhausts. In areas specifically susceptible to air pollution, such innovations are not simply useful but needed, offering a lasting alternative that lines up with global ecological objectives. Besides, the reduction in roadway website traffic, thanks to airborne shipments, converts to fewer traffic and reduced emissions of dangerous particulates, thus enhancing the total quality of metropolitan life.

Still, the journey of integrating delivery drones into every day life is met its reasonable share of challenges. Regulatory frameworks stay a work in development, advancing to match the rate of technical advancement. Security issues, especially in largely inhabited locations, need extensive testing and oversight. Problems like privacy, sound pollution, and air web traffic control are ever-present, requiring continuous discussion between tech designers, regulative bodies, and the public to make sure drones are as inconspicuous and effective as possible. Public perception, as well, plays a vital role in this transition; while many sight drones as a testimony to human development, others might see them as intrusive. Consequently, openness in functional procedures and constant community engagement become critical avenues for cultivating approval.
